ITU-T 和 ISO-IEC 是两个不同的国际标准组织,H.264/AVC 为什么要冠以两个组织的名称呢?因为在 2001 年的 12 月, ITU-T 的VCEG(Video Coding Experts Group)和 ISO-IEC 的 Moving Picture Experts Group(MPEG)联合成立了一个新的机构叫JVT(Joint Video Team),就是这个新的组织 JVT 于 2003 年 3 月 ...
保留编码格式:ffmpeg -i test.mp4 -vcodec copy -an test_copy.h264 强制格式:ffmpeg -i test.mp4 -vcodec libx264 -an test.h264 然后用010Editor打开提取的h264文件,如下所示: H264 分成两种流格式,一种是 Annex-B 格式(上图看到的就是这种格式),一种是 RTP 包流的格式。 Annex-B 格式是默认的输...
H.264/AVC 概述视频编码标准 H.264/AVC,即 H.264/MPEG-4 part 10 AVC,由国际电信标准化部门 ITU-T(原名 CCIT,缩写自法语)和国际标准化组织-国际电工委员会 ISO-IEC 合作制定。1993年,MPEG-1的mp3标准之外,两个组织分别在视频领域展开研究。1984年,ITU-T 发布 H.120,后续发展为 H.26...
H.264/AVC的分层结构和画面划分是其关键组成部分,它们影响了编码和传输效率。首先,H.264的分层处理将视频压缩过程分为两个层次,从像素数据输入到适应不同网络速率的码流输出。这个分层结构不仅体现在数据处理流程上,也直接关联到码流的NALU序列,即码流由一系列包含NAL头和RBSP的NALU单元组成。画面划分...
H.264 / AVC标准是由ITU-T和ISO / IEC联合开发的,旨在覆盖整个视频应用领域,包括:低比特率无线应用,标清和高清高品质电视广播应用, Internet上的视频流应用程序,高清DVD视频的传输以及数码相机的高质量视频应用程序等。 ITU-T将此标准命名为H.264(以前称为H.26L),而ISO / IEC则将其称为MPEG。
264的帧间预测块尺寸包含了16x16到4x4。 每个宏块(16x16)可以使用4种方式进行划分:1个16x16,2个16x8,2个8x16,4个8x8,叫做宏块划分。 在8x8的情况下,子宏块还可以继续划分:1个8x8,2个4x8,2个8x4,4个4x4,叫做子宏块划分。 上述划分方式的简单示意图如下: ...
高级视频编码 (AVC),也称为 H.264,是当今使用的最常见的视频压缩标准。AVC/H.264 能够以比旧压缩标准更低的比特率编码高质量视频(“比特率”是每秒视频必须处理的信息单位数)。 蓝光和各种流式传输服务,包括点播和直播电视,都使用 H.264。尽管它的使用有时需要向拥有专利的组织支付版税,但超过 90% 的视频行...
H264是MPEG-4的第十部分,是由ITU-T和ISO/IEC两大组织联合提出的视频编解码标准,这个标准通常被称之为H.264/AVC。H264编码是一种主流编码方式,本文主要从数据处理的角度对H264视频码流进行分析。二、H264码流结构 H264原始码流(裸流)是由多个NAL单元组成的,具体如下图所示:NALU单元是由什么组成的呢?
H.264/AVC标准是由ITU-T和ISO/IEC联合开发的,定位于覆盖整个视频应用领域,包括:低码率的无线应用、标准清晰度和高清晰度的电视广播应用、Internet上的视频流应用,传输高清晰度的DVD视频以及应用于数码相机的高质量视频应用等等。 ITU-T给这个标准命名为H.264(以前叫做H.26L),而ISO/IEC称它为MPEG-4 高级视频编码...